Transaction 68159d587b5b2649f4596f9aa0c48a639cec37a4d33de5d29d09f18dc4ffa7d3
1 Input
1 Output
-
68159d587b5b2649f4596f9aa0c48a639cec37a4d33de5d29d09f18dc4ffa7d3:0
- value
- 502803
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9eb90717667c6c2a2e2eaa3c1c7eec49bca2b36a OP_EQUAL
- address
- 3GAGLoXX7FntnysiTMfX1rqiYqB7Ef6Puk